Aciotis

Aciotis is a genus of flowering plants belonging to the family Melastomataceae. These plants are native to the tropical regions of the Americas, ranging from Mexico and the Caribbean islands south to South America.

Characteristics of Aciotis species often include herbaceous or subshrubby habits. Their leaves are typically opposite and simple, with characteristic venation patterns. The flowers are usually small and borne in clusters or panicles. The petals are often white or pink. The fruit is generally a capsule.

Aciotis species are found in a variety of habitats, including moist forests, savannas, and along streams. They contribute to the biodiversity of these ecosystems.
